
Practice Manager

Main tasks
- The post holder is responsible for managing the practice’s staff and budgets, resolving patient complaints, recruitment, developing the practice’s business strategy and making sure that the business runs efficiently and smoothly.
- Core objectives include:
- Development and maintenance of appropriate human resource systems, including staff files and necessary documentation and familiarity with current awards
*
- Recruiting, induction and training of new staff.
- Supervising staff to ensure high performance and continuing professional development
- Reviewing and improving practice systems to ensure the smooth and efficient functioning of the practice, high quality service and continuous improvement
- Dealing with accounts and budgets, managing payroll and making sure the practice meets its financial targets
- Ensure the business is compliant with all statutory and regulatory obligations, including industrial and employment law, Medicare, OHS requirements, privacy obligations and taxation responsibilities
- Managing the reception and appointment system
- Managing manual and computerised medical records systems
- Controlling stock including practice equipment, stationery and any medical supplies as required
- Organising the practice premises cleaning, maintenance and security
- Developing and reviewing employment contracts, job descriptions and performance appraisals
- Maintaining strict patient confidentiality
- Actively taking steps to recruit doctors and Allied Health
- Actively managing social media accounts
Other Areas of Responsibility
- Managing and delegating tasks
- Conflict resolution
- Contributing to and leading the team
- Attending and participating in practice meetings
Other Duties
- Fulfil other duties as required by management and other departmental personnel as requested/required
Experience
Required Competencies
- **Customer service focused**:committed to providing exceptional customer service across all channels - written, phone and face to face
- **Communication**:the ability to communicate clearly and concisely**, **varying communication style depending upon the audience
- Attention to detail: excellent attention to detail and written skills when communicating with others, both internally and externally
- **Energy, commitment and drive**:dedication to the role; willingness to show flexibility when required; enthusiasm for the role and company development
- Teamwork: willingness to assist and support others as required and get on with team members
- Relationship-orientation: be able to build rapport and trust with others to forge meaningful business relationships
- Time management/organisation: accomplish objectives effectively within time frame given, carry out administrative duties in an efficient and timely manner
